M1Motorsport Retains Third in 2012 NZSBK Championship
The five round NZSBK Castrol Championship drew to a close yesterday, at Taupo Motorsport park.
For M1Motorsport, it was a series of highs and lows with a couple of DNF’s thrown into the mix which re-enforced exactly how circumstances can change over the course of a five round championship.
For all competitors, a test of endurance and stamina.
“It was without a doubt disappointing that we DNF’ed, but that’s racing.”
Sloan added, “I’m absolutely stoked that we’ve retained our third place in New Zealand Superbikes.
We gave it everything we had. We were challenged and learnt a lot, which we’ll retain and bring to next year’s 2013 NZSBK campaign.”
Team M1Motorsport congratulate all competitors and further team Triple R’s Robbie Bugden, 2012 New Zealand champion and team Stroud’s nine times New Zealand Superbike champion; Andrew Stroud, for securing second place.

Top 5 final championship points:
Robbie Bugden 182.5
Andrew Stroud 145
Sloan Frost 124.5
Nick Cole 120.5
Craig Shirriffs 114
